Hi, the first error message was found in gethub platform, I used the get hub build to setup the version and it was successful installed and run ok but when I click on comfortupdate I see the error message.

Then I downloaded the same build and version from LimeSruvey server, and I got the message: Internal Server Error
CDbConnection failed to open the DB connection.

All my credential are good. this is an archived issue I think.

Try to test it by yourself and you will see. just download from this link: www.limesurvey.org/stable-release/file/2...19zip?tmpl=component

Extract the files in your server, and run it. immediately you will get the error: Internal Server Error
CDbConnection failed to open the DB connection.


I have figured out the issue: in the zip folder in the limesurvy Archive content already the file: config.php
This file should be removed in order to install. as this file will be created after the installation is done.

Because this file already exists in the archive folder, so the installation thinks that you already installed limesruvey.
